Lengthy, 10-foot cable Cons Not compatible with Android or other consoles Doesnt house arcade-quality parts out of the box (but you can easily add them yourself) Lacks a tournament-friendly, button-lock switch Four years ago, 8Bitdo released the N30 Arcade Stick, a Bluetooth controller that worked with PCs, Android devices, and the Nintendo Switch. Its follow-up, the simply named 8Bitdo Arcade Stick, is an improvement in almost every way. The $89.99 joystick has a heavier, more substantial buil...
